#ifndef STRINGTABLE_H
|
|
#define STRINGTABLE_H
|
|
|
|
#include <string.h>
|
|
|
|
#include <vector>
|
|
#include <string>
|
|
|
|
using namespace std;
|
|
|
|
#include "elf.h"
|
|
#include "swap.h"
|
|
#include "image.h"
|
|
#include "section.h"
|
|
#include "complain.h"
|
|
|
|
|
|
using namespace std;
|
|
|
|
class StringTable : public Section {
|
|
|
|
public:
|
|
StringTable(Image& newImage)
|
|
: Section(newImage, string(".strtab"), SHT_STRTAB, 0, 0, (uint8_t *)calloc(1, 1), 1)
|
|
{
|
|
// strtab containing the empty string, unless read() replaces it
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void read(Elf32_Shdr *shdr)
|
|
{
|
|
Section::read(shdr);
|
|
|
|
char *strings = (char *)malloc(mSize);
|
|
memcpy(strings, mContents, mSize);
|
|
mContents = (uint8_t *)strings;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
string operator[](int offset) const
|
|
{
|
|
return string((char *)mContents+offset);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void addString(const string& str)
|
|
{
|
|
const char *cstr = str.c_str();
|
|
int len = strlen(cstr) + 1;
|
|
mContents = (uint8_t *)realloc((char *)mContents, mSize + len);
|
|
memcpy((char *)mContents + mSize, cstr, len);
|
|
mSize += len;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
int indexOf(const string& str) const
|
|
{
|
|
const char *cstr = str.c_str();
|
|
const char *strings = (const char *)mContents;
|
|
for (const char *s = strings;
|
|
s < strings+mSize;
|
|
s++)
|
|
{
|
|
if (0 == strcmp(s, cstr)) return s - strings;
|
|
}
|
|
error("string %s not in strtab", cstr);
|
|
return -1;
|
|
}
|
|
};
|
|
|
|
#endif
